Yard Congestion

Postby mire3212 » Thu Apr 09, 2015 3:39 am

I seem to have this issue in every prison I've built so far where the yard gets extremely crowded at just the entrance and they don't move INTO the yard. This is causing riots right at the gate and people die, things explode and all hell breaks lose.

My yard is definitely big enough to fit people without them sitting on top of each other, but they seem to love each other so much that they refuse to separate.

Prisoners tend to cluster near doors if they have nothing better to do, particularly if they have needs that can be satisfied by things beyond the door.

You could also consider putting in some different items into your yard. It's kinda sparse, so there aren't many needs that can be met there. I typically put in phone booths, weight benches, pool tables, TVs, even a couple of toilets (yard often ends up being right after a two-hour lunch block and some work before that, so by the end of lunch, bladder/bowels need is usually very high).

Note: Paving stones work as a disperser ... prisoners don't stay standing on those.
So just pave the entrance and you should be fine.

another solution (because I have this problem with many rooms - yards, canteens, showers) is to de-zone the first few tiles around the door, so that they actually have to move four or five squares into the yard itself, before the game recognises that they are in the room. In my experience, they cluster much less.

Within prisons its normal to see at least
- pavement ... for fast walking
- place benches + tables & pews ... to sit
- excercise equipment
- a toilet

works for a 200+ prison all going to the Yard at the same time.
It still takes a bit for prisoners to disperse, but they'll end up far away from the entrance.
